xen/x86/PCI: Add support for the Xen PCI subsystem

The frontend stub lives in arch/x86/pci/xen.c, alongside other
sub-arch PCI init code (e.g. olpc.c).

It provides a mechanism for Xen PCI frontend to setup/destroy
legacy interrupts, MSI/MSI-X, and PCI configuration operations.

[ Impact: add core of Xen PCI support ]

diff --git a/arch/x86/pci/xen.c b/arch/x86/pci/xen.c
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..b19c873
--- /dev/null
+++ b/arch/x86/pci/xen.c
@@ -0,0 +1,147 @@
+/*
+ * Xen PCI Frontend Stub - puts some "dummy" functions in to the Linux
+ *			   x86 PCI core to support the Xen PCI Frontend
+ *
+ *   Author: Ryan Wilson <hap9@epoch.ncsc.mil>
+ */
+#include <linux/module.h>
+#include <linux/init.h>
+#include <linux/pci.h>
+#include <linux/acpi.h>
+
+#include <linux/io.h>
+#include <asm/pci_x86.h>
+
+#include <asm/xen/hypervisor.h>
+
+#include <xen/events.h>
+#include <asm/xen/pci.h>
+
+#if defined(CONFIG_PCI_MSI)
+#include <linux/msi.h>
+
+struct xen_pci_frontend_ops *xen_pci_frontend;
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(xen_pci_frontend);
+
+/*
+ * For MSI interrupts we have to use drivers/xen/event.s functions to
+ * allocate an irq_desc and setup the right */
+
+
+static int xen_setup_msi_irqs(struct pci_dev *dev, int nvec, int type)
+{
+	int irq, ret, i;
+	struct msi_desc *msidesc;
+	int *v;
+
+	v = kzalloc(sizeof(int) * max(1, nvec),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!v)
+		return -ENOMEM;
+
+	if (!xen_initial_domain()) {
+		if (type == PCI_CAP_ID_MSIX)
+			ret = xen_pci_frontend_enable_msix(dev, &v, nvec);
+		else
+			ret = xen_pci_frontend_enable_msi(dev, &v);
+		if (ret)
+			goto error;
+	}
+	i = 0;
+	list_for_each_entry(msidesc, &dev->msi_list, list) {
+		irq = xen_allocate_pirq(v[i], 0, /* not sharable */
+			(type == PCI_CAP_ID_MSIX) ?
+			"pcifront-msi-x" : "pcifront-msi");
+		if (irq < 0)
+			return -1;
+
+		ret = set_irq_msi(irq, msidesc);
+		if (ret)
+			goto error_while;
+		i++;
+	}
+	kfree(v);
+	return 0;
+
+error_while:
+	unbind_from_irqhandler(irq, NULL);
+error:
+	if (ret == -ENODEV)
+		dev_err(&dev->dev, "Xen PCI frontend has not registered" \
+			" MSI/MSI-X support!\n");
+
+	kfree(v);
+	return ret;
+}
+
+static void xen_teardown_msi_irqs(struct pci_dev *dev)
+{
+	/* Only do this when were are in non-privileged mode.*/
+	if (!xen_initial_domain()) {
+		struct msi_desc *msidesc;
+
+		msidesc = list_entry(dev->msi_list.next, struct msi_desc, list);
+		if (msidesc->msi_attrib.is_msix)
+			xen_pci_frontend_disable_msix(dev);
+		else
+			xen_pci_frontend_disable_msi(dev);
+	}
+
+}
+
+static void xen_teardown_msi_irq(unsigned int irq)
+{
+	xen_destroy_irq(irq);
+}
+#endif
+
+static int xen_pcifront_enable_irq(struct pci_dev *dev)
+{
+	int rc;
+	int share = 1;
+
+	dev_info(&dev->dev, "Xen PCI enabling IRQ: %d\n", dev->irq);
+
+	if (dev->irq < 0)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	if (dev->irq < NR_IRQS_LEGACY)
+		share = 0;
+
+	rc = xen_allocate_pirq(dev->irq, share, "pcifront");
+	if (rc < 0) {
+		dev_warn(&dev->dev, "Xen PCI IRQ: %d, failed to register:%d\n",
+			 dev->irq, rc);
+		return rc;
+	}
+	return 0;
+}
+
+int __init pci_xen_init(void)
+{
+	if (!xen_pv_domain() || xen_initial_domain())
+		return -ENODEV;
+
+	printk(KERN_INFO "PCI: setting up Xen PCI frontend stub\n");
+
+	pcibios_set_cache_line_size();
+
+	pcibios_enable_irq = xen_pcifront_enable_irq;
+	pcibios_disable_irq = NULL;
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_ACPI
+	/* Keep ACPI out of the picture */
+	acpi_noirq = 1;
+#endif
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_ISAPNP
+	/* Stop isapnp from probing */
+	isapnp_disable = 1;
+#endif
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_PCI_MSI
+	x86_msi.setup_msi_irqs = xen_setup_msi_irqs;
+	x86_msi.teardown_msi_irq = xen_teardown_msi_irq;
+	x86_msi.teardown_msi_irqs = xen_teardown_msi_irqs;
+#endif
+	return 0;
+}
